Summary: CouchDB daemon terminates when the computer goes to sleep
Key: COUCHDB-1499
UR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/COUCHDB-1499
Project: CouchDB
Issue Type: Bug
Components: Infrastructure
Affects Versions: 1.2, 1.1.1
Environment: OS X 10.6.8
Reporter: Ivan Krechetov
Priority: Minor
Log entries on sleep and wake up:
heart: Mon Jun 18 18:28:11 2012: heart-beat time-out.
heart: Mon Jun 18 20:52:23 2012: Executed
"/usr/local/Cellar/couchdb/1.2.0/bin/couchdb -k". Terminating.
heart_beat_kill_pid = 62249
heart_beat_timeout = 11
Then, I just start it manually again, after the OS wakes up:
Apache CouchDB 1.2.0 (LogLevel=info) is starting.
Apache CouchDB has started. Time to relax.
[info] [<0.31.0>] Apache CouchDB has started on http://127.0.0.1:5984/
